
| Regimental number | 2252 |
| Place of birth | Dungog, New South Wales |
| Religion | Methodist |
| Occupation | Tailor |
| Address | Dungog, New South Wales |
| Marital status | Single |
| Age at embarkation | 22.6 |
| Height | 5' 7" |
| Weight | 148 lbs |
| Next of kin | Mother, Mrs M A Brown, Dungog, New South Wales |
| Previous military service | Served for 2 years in the Senior (Voluntary) Cadets. |
| Enlistment date | |
| Place of enlistment | Liverpool, New South Wales |
| Rank on enlistment | Private |
| Unit name | 2nd Battalion, 6th Reinforcement |
| Embarkation details | Unit embarked from Sydney, New South Wales, on board HMAT Karoola on |
| Rank from Nominal Roll | Private |
| Unit from Nominal Roll | 2nd Battalion |
| Fate | Returned to Australia |
| Discharge date | |
| Other details |
War service: Egypt, Gallipoli Commenced return to Australia from Suez on board HT 'Port Sydney', 24 June 1916; discharged (medically unfit: wounded, gun shot wound, right thigh), Sydney, 24 August 1916. Medals: 1914-15 Star, British War Medal, Victory Medal |
